Catalog description

Applies problem-solving skills in order to maintain and monitor process equipment employing cause and effect analyses, case studies, analytical techniques, and laboratory simulations. Involves troubleshooting, maintaining, monitoring unit problems, and working with others to solve real world problems. <BR>Prerequisite: None. <BR>(PCS 1.2, 4 credit hours; 3 hours lecture, 2 hours lab)
